Governor, Bank of England; Chair of the MPC - Casting-vote rate cutter as the committee nears a contested “neutral” level
This cut had courtroom drama energy. The Bank of England dropped rates to 3.75%—but only because Governor Andrew Bailey switched his vote and made it 5–4. The immediate market read was hawkish-by-UK-standards: sterling rose and gilt yields ticked higher as traders pared back expectations for rapid 2026 easing.

Former Attorney General of Missouri - Filed the core lawsuit that first put SAVE under the Eighth Circuit’s microscope.
Joe Biden sold the SAVE plan as a fix for a broken student loan system: smaller payments, faster forgiveness, and protection from ballooning interest for millions. Eighteen months, two Supreme Court losses, and a barrage of lawsuits later, Donald Trump’s Education Department has cut a deal with Missouri and other Republican-led states to kill SAVE and shove its 7‑plus million borrowers into more expensive plans.
